Sunak was warned of Zahawi reputational risk in October, say sources

PM allegedly given advice about inquiry into minister’s taxes when he appointed him Tory party chair

Rishi Sunak was told there could be a reputational risk to the government from Nadhim Zahawi’s tax affairs when he appointed him as Conservative party chair in October, sources have told the Observer.

During the period when the prime minister was drawing up his new cabinet, senior government officials gave him informal advice about the risks from an HMRC investigation that had been settled just months earlier, sources said.
